MyWineMine gives this wine a score of 915; outperforming the average for the sub-region in 2012 which is 879. The average score for Château Bélair-Monange is 876, making this an above average effort for the producer.

When people talk about wines from Château Bélair-Monange they use words like Full, Black, Fruit, Tannins, Dense, Christian, Sweet, Ripe, Finesse, Crushed, Mediocre, Ruby, Oak, Rich, Purple. The 2012 shares most of these characteristics. People use these words to describe the 2012 but no other wine from Château Bélair-Monange: Superstar, Alder, Currant, Damson, Carries, Racy, Rind, Solid, Young, Citrus. It normally takes wines from Château Bélair-Monange around 7 years to be ready to start drinking, and 13 further years to decline.
